After breakfast proceed for darshan - Maa Sharda Devi Temple: Maihar is known for the Maa Sharda devi temple (around of 502 A.D.), situated at the top of Trikoota hills. There are 1,063 steps to reach the top of the hill. Along with stairs, there is ropeway for convenience of the pilgrims developed government authorities. After competition proceed to Gola Math Temple: This temple is dedicated to Lord Shiva. This east facing Pancharathi temple is built in Nagara style and has been built during Kalchuri period (10th – 11th century A.D.). It is said that this temple was built in one fortnight only. This morning after breakfast, check-out & depart to Bandhavgarh National Park. It is located in the central Indian state of Madhya Pradesh. This biodiverse park is known for its large population of royal Bengal tigers, especially in the central Tala zone. Other animals include white tigers, leopards and deer. The mix of tropical forest, Sal trees and grassland is home to scores of bird species, including eagles. To the south are the remains of the ancient Bandhavgarh Fort.
